What affects the price

Cruise pricing shifts based on a few key variables. Your cabin category is the biggest factor; choosing a suite or a room with a balcony naturally costs more than an interior cabin. Where you choose to sail and how far out you book also play a significant role. Last-minute deals can sometimes save you money, but booking early often secures better perks or specific room locations. What is the cheapest month to cruise?

The most affordable times to cruise are generally during the shoulder seasons, like September, October, and late January through March, avoiding holidays. Demand is lower during these periods, often leading to better prices. It's a smart way to save. Call us for a free quote to find current deals.

What is the cheapest month to go on a cruise?

The cheapest months for cruises departing from the West Coast are typically September and October, after the summer crowds have left and before the holiday season. January and February, excluding holiday weeks, can also offer lower prices. This is an ideal time for budget-savvy travelers. Call us for a free estimate.
